Classic Slots Outside GamStop

Classic slots maintain their appeal through straightforward gameplay mechanics and nostalgic design elements that recall classic fruit machines. These games usually include three reels, limited paylines, and familiar symbols such as fruits, bars, sevens, and bells. Their straightforward nature appeals to players who prefer uncomplicated gaming sessions without elaborate bonus features or complex rules requiring extensive learning curves.

Popular classic slot titles at non-GamStop sites include Mega Joker, Jackpot 6000, and Break da Bank, which combine vintage aesthetics with contemporary technical performance. These games often incorporate bonus features like nudges, holds, and gamble options that enhance strategic depth whilst maintaining their traditional character. The reduced volatility of many classic slots attracts players seeking steady, frequent wins rather than chasing massive jackpots.

Growing Prize Slots

Progressive jackpot slots constitute the pinnacle of potential winnings at non-GamStop casinos, with prize pools that accumulate across multiple platforms until a fortunate gambler triggers the grand prize. Games like Mega Moolah, Divine Fortune, and Hall of Gods have generated countless millionaires through their network jackpots. These titles combine engaging base gameplay with the exhilarating chance of life-changing wins from a one spin.

The inner workings behind progressive slots involve a small percentage of each wager contributing to multiple jackpot tiers, which can climb to millions of pounds before being won. Many progressive games feature multiple jackpot levels—mini, minor, major, and mega—giving gamblers various winning opportunities. Whilst the odds of hitting the grand jackpot remain slim, the entertainment value and prospect of a substantial win keep these games among the most popular choices.
